RECOIL EXERCISER INSTRUCTIONS – CONTINUED
b.
Operation. – Continued
WARNING
Be sure hands, arms, and loose clothing are clear of cannon tube and breech prior to removing the
wooden block to prevent injury to personnel.
8
If using electric hydraulic pump (22), place manual valve (27) in upright position. Using the electric hydraulic
pump, begin pumping to move the cannon tube off of the wooden block. Remove wooden block.
9
If using electric hydraulic pump (22), turn manual valve (27). Release hydraulic pressure at the electric hy-
draulic pump allowing cannon tube (2) to return to battery.
10
Repeat steps 3, 4, 5, and 9.
11
Repeat steps 3, 4, and 5.
WARNING
The cannon tube must be blocked while lubricating to prevent cannon tube from returning to battery
resulting in injury to personnel.
12
Block cannon (2) while out of battery with a 4”x4”x12” wooden block (29). Hold wooden block in position and
slowly release pump pressure until wooden block stops cannon tube movement. Coat exposed buffer piston
rod (28) surface lightly with hydraulic fluid (item 21, Appx D).
WARNING
Be sure hands, arms, and loose clothing are clear of cannon tube and breech prior to removing the
wooden block to prevent injury to personnel.
13
If using electric hydraulic pump (22), place manual valve (27) in upright position. Using the electric hydraulic
pump, begin pumping to move the cannon tube off of the wooden block. Remove wooden block.
14
If using electric hydraulic pump (22), turn manual valve (27). Release hydraulic pressure at electric hydraulic
pump allowing cannon tube (2) to return to battery.
